#Di Gi Charat Mascot Franchise Green-lights New Mini Anime

During its June 12 livestream, the Di Gi Charat Mascot Franchise announced that a new mini anime has been green-lit for production. The new anime is part of the Reiwa no Di Gi Charat project that marks the franchise’s 24th anniversary and also celebrates the current Reiwa Era in Japan.

Hiroaki Sakurai (Maid Sama!, The Disastrous Life of Saiki K. franchise) returns to direct the new mini anime at LIDEN Films, while Atsuko Watanabe (Place to Place, Heavy Object) is in charge of character design. The franchise’s original character designer Koge-Donbo* illustrated the new key visual.

The new anime will feature a new character named Bushirodo-no-Mikoto or “Bushi-chan,” who is Bushiroad’s guardian deity born in 2007, which is the year the company was founded. 

Returning cast members include Asami Sanada as Di Gi Charat, Miyuki Sawashiro as Petit Charat, Kyoko Hikami as Rabi~en~Rose, Yoshiko Kamei as Gema, Megumi Hayashibara as Piyocola Analogue III, Kōsuke Toriumi as Rik Heisenberg, Chihiro Suzuki as Ky Schweitzer, and Tomo Saeki as Coo Erhard. Satomi Akesaka is voicing Brocco-desu, the goddess of Broccoli.

The Di Gi Charat franchise features mascot characters of media company Broccoli and retail chain GAMERS. The franchise was launched in 1998 has included manga, anime, and video games adaptations, and hosted voice actor events since launch. The original 16-episode Di Gi Charat television anime series aired in 1999.
